未验证 提交 7a880f5e 编写于 作者: A Aki Rodić 提交者: GitHub

Added pen support to EditorControls.

Right now, editor controls dont work with pen pointer because `event.pointerType === "pen"` is ignored. This patch fixes it.
上级 579d0e3e
...@@ -121,6 +121,7 @@ function EditorControls( object, domElement ) { ...@@ -121,6 +121,7 @@ function EditorControls( object, domElement ) {
switch ( event.pointerType ) { switch ( event.pointerType ) {
case 'mouse': case 'mouse':
case 'pen':
onMouseDown( event ); onMouseDown( event );
break; break;
...@@ -140,6 +141,7 @@ function EditorControls( object, domElement ) { ...@@ -140,6 +141,7 @@ function EditorControls( object, domElement ) {
switch ( event.pointerType ) { switch ( event.pointerType ) {
case 'mouse': case 'mouse':
case 'pen':
onMouseMove( event ); onMouseMove( event );
break; break;
...@@ -154,6 +156,7 @@ function EditorControls( object, domElement ) { ...@@ -154,6 +156,7 @@ function EditorControls( object, domElement ) {
switch ( event.pointerType ) { switch ( event.pointerType ) {
case 'mouse': case 'mouse':
case 'pen':
onMouseUp(); onMouseUp();
break; break;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册